About City

Miami is an American city and is the cultural, financial and economical center of South Florida. Miami has an area of about 56 square miles. It is situated between the Everglades to the west and Biscayne to the east. Miami is the 6th most populated city in USA. It has a population of around 470,914. Miami is major in finance, culture, entertainment, arts, commerce and international trade. Miami is one of the most popular vacation spots. It is famous for its white sand surfside hotels, trendsetting night clubs and colorful art deco buildings.

ECONOMIC CONDITION
 
Miami is a major center of commerce and finance and boasts a strong international business community. According to the 2018 ranking of world cities undertaken by the Globalization and World Cities Research Network (GaWC) based on the level of presence of global corporate service organizations, Miami is considered an Alpha level world city. Miami has a Gross Metropolitan Product of $257 billion, ranking 11th in the United States and 20th worldwide in GMP.
